RE: Retro-fitting ceramic brakes
I checked into this prior to ordering my car and they told me it would be about 14,000 CHF (Swiss francs) to retrofit. I decided to just order the car with them as it was a 9,500 CHF option to do it at the factory. After having PCCB's on my Porsche I couldn't imagine not having the ceramics. However...
